Before you schedule a consultation with a psychiatrist, it's essential to understand how much you'll be expected to pay. Co-payments are a flat fee which are usually an amount of the total cost of a visit. These fees can differ based on the insurance company and the nature of the visit. If you are unsure of the exact amount you should expect to pay, you should contact your insurance company for more details. Psychiatrists can also negotiate with you to negotiate an arrangement for payment for those who are unable afford the full cost of treatment.

The majority of health insurance plans cover visits to a psychiatrist However, the amount of coverage you receive will depend on your insurer and whether you choose an in-network provider. In-network psychiatrists are usually cheaper than out-of-network psychiatrists. However when you have a high deductible you might have to pay more out-of-pocket expenses to reach your deductible.
